The converter is comprised of a 4thorder, deltasigma modulator followed by a programmable digital filter. Ads1256 data ready output, low active 12 reset ads1256 reset input pdwn ads1256 syncpower off input, low active 15 cs0 ads1256 chip select, low active 16 cs1 dac8552 chip select, low active 19 din spi data input 21 dout spi data output 23 sck spi clock 31, 33, 35, 37 gpio extend to sensor interface photos highprecision adda board back. The spi master driver is disabled by default on raspbian. Ads1256 pdf, ads1256 description, ads1256 datasheets. Onboard ads1256, 8ch 24bit highprecision adc 4ch differential input, 30ksps sampling rate. Burrbrown, al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. It keeps reading all the ads1256 channels in absolute and voltage values and saving to a csv file until a break from the user to test it, run the following.
Ads1256evmpdk performance demonstration kit for ads1256, 24bit, low noise analog to digital converter. Ti industrial, 14ksps, 24bit analogtodigital converter with lowdrift reference,alldatasheet, datasheet, datasheet search site for electronic. Industrial, 14ksps, 24bit analogtodigital converter with lowdrift reference, ads1256 pdf download, ads1256 download, ads1256 down, ads1256 pdf down, ads1256 pdf download, ads1256 datasheets, ads1256 pdf, ads1256 circuit. All data rates and pga settings up to 23 bits noisefree resolution 0. Onboard ads1256, 8ch 24bit highprecision adc 4ch differential input, 30ksps sampling. However, first as i have read elsewhere it seems timing is critical.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files the software, to deal in the software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, andor sell copies of the software, and to permit. I import ads1256 from pipyadc, then initialize it in my main with the following. The ads it s a process of analysis, permits to extract or to verify the properties of a system analog or digital system. Getting waveshare highprecision adda expansion board to work. I am fairly new to the microcontroller world having taken one class way back in college on it.
Pdf sigma delta analogue to digital converters have been used in many. Electronic component documentation datasheet ads1255. This design also has a dc dc converter and optical isolation to allow a ads1256 to be used as a add on shield or board for a boarduino or arduino board. Buy raspberry pi adda expansion shield board onboard ads1256 dac8552 sensor supports adding highprecision adda functions to raspberry pi with fast shipping and toprated customer service. Softwareentwicklung fur eine datenerfassungsplattform zur. Hello i am having problems interfacing with a ads1256 24 bit adc using the spi interface with a bs2.
To enable it, use raspiconfig, or ensure the line dtparamspion isnt commented out in bootconfig. Get detailed views of sql server performance, anomaly detection powered by machine learning, historic information that lets you go back in time, regardless if its a physical server, virtualized, or in the cloud. Using an ads1255 basically the same ic as ads1256 and dariosalvi code got my ads1255 working btw the sample code was missing spi. Contribute to mbilskyads1256andarduino development by creating an account on github. Currently only implemented class in this module is ads1256 for the ads1255 and ads1256 chips which are register and command compatible. Raspberry pi adda expansion sheild board for adding high.
Ti industrial, 14ksps, 24bit analogtodigital converter with lowdrift reference,alldatasheet, datasheet. Ads1256 features the ads1255 and ads1256 are extremely lownoise,24 bits, no missing codes. Actually, it is not the ground for the analog section. Ti industrial, 14ksps, 24bit analogtodigital converter with lowdrift reference,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Burrbrown very low noise, 24bit analogtodigital converter,alldatasheet, datasheet, datasheet search site for electronic components and semiconductors, integrated circuits, diodes, triacs, and other semiconductors. Raspberry pi adda expansion shield board onboard ads1256. Simple library for ads1256 to be used with arduino. Configuration drdy pin for external interrupt is triggered. In my university there are a lot of old soviet science equipment that work fine but it instone age. If the spi driver was loaded, you should see the device devspidev0. Development of a real time axial force measurement. Onboard dac8532, 2ch 16bit highprecision dac onboard input interface via pinheaders, for connecting analog signal. Ads1256 24bit adc8 road adprecision adc data acquisition. The software is designed to run with the microsoft windows operating system and allows for the complete evaluation of the ads1256 device.
The ads1256 chip is a high precision 24bit, 8 channel, analog digital converter based on spi communication that is suitable for biomedical applications and perfect for sensing ecg and eeg signals. Pdf an investigation of the use of a high resolution adc as a. Ads1256 performance demonstration kit texas instruments. They provide complete highresolution measurement solutions for the most demanding applications. A library for the charge n boost lithium charger and usb booster. Idea was to buil universal research system for automatization research.
The ads1255 and ads1256 are extremely lownoise, 24bit analogtodigital ad converters. The raspberry pi is equipped with one spi bus that has 2 chip selects. Similar boards are available on fleabay, banggood, aliexpress and so on. Python library with c wrappers to read 8 channels from the texas instruments ads1256 adc chip fabiovixpyads1256. Contribute to flydroidads12xxlibrary development by creating an account on github. The ads1256evmpdk is a complete evaluationdemonstration kit, which combines the ads1256evm with the dspbased mmb0 motherboard for use with a personal computer.
Ads1256 24bit, 30ksps, 8ch deltasigma adc with pga for. Ads1256 datasheet, ads1256 datasheets, ads1256 pdf, ads1256 circuit. A convenience library for using a common lcd shield available from sainsmart, dfrobot, hiletgo, robotdyne and others. Ads1256 8 road 24bit adc module mounted ti ads1256idb,minimum power consumption. Contribute to mbilskyads1256 andarduino development by creating an account on github. Ads1256 datasheet, ads1256 pdf, ads1256 data sheet, ads1256 manual, ads1256 pdf, ads1256, datenblatt, electronics ads1256, alldatasheet, free, datasheet, datasheets. It newer be finished because i have no funds for finish it and my research facility have no funds to. The input converter chip ads1256 was a bit more complicated. Resonators with the ads12556, available for download at. Very low noise, 24bit analogtodigital converter, ads1256 datasheet, ads1256 circuit, ads1256 data sheet. Python module for interfacing texas instruments spi bus based analog todigital converters with the raspberry pi. Ive adapted the code a bit to match my setup and configured one more register drate in order to make sure the adc is working at its full 30ksps potential and the. It does not implement the whole set of features, but can be used as a starting point for a more comprehensive library.
Previously i was working with an mcp3008 i am testing this board out because of the increase in precision for voltage measurements and gpiozero was a great library for that chip. I am getting 0s back when i try to read its registers here is the source code and a link to the form post on sparkfuns. The adc on the board is an ads1256, and i am having trouble finding code libraries to use with it. Ads1256evmpdk ads1256 performance demonstration kit. The mmb0 motherboard allows the ads1256evm to connect to a computer via a usb port. Usually this would be connected to a reference or ground that is used for single ended inputs.
Aincom is not an input, its the ground pin for the ics analog section. Stm32f103 and ads1256 are used to build a data acquisition system. The ads1256evmpdk is controlled by the adcpro evaluation software using a plugin. Universal measure and control system for science purposes.
Search ads1256 vhdl, 300 results found simple vhdl in persian. Openeeg sourceforge download, develop and publish free. Raspberry pi adda board library for window 10 iot core. It does not implement the whole set of features, but can be used as a starting point for a.326 462 335 640 1054 640 6 32 512 681 514 1242 1613 303 1391 1057 568 1231 249 186 1298 134 1380 955 670 245 1195 462 826 888 1031 371 693 582 1473 891 540 157 861 593